About Generation YES Corp
Youth and Educators Succeeding, formerly known as Generation YES, was a U.S. based non-profit organization that works with schools around the world to empower underserved students and ensure that technology investments in education are both cost effective and meaningful. Dr. Dennis Harper was the founder and CEO from 1996 to 2020; upon his retirement, Adam F.C. Fletcher succeeded him. YES programs

What Is the Cost of Living Near Olympia?

Understanding the cost of living near Olympia is key to truly evaluating a salary offer or your current compensation at Generation YES Corp.
Olympia's Cost of Living Index is approximately 107.3 (7.3% more expensive than US average; 3.8% less than WA average). State capital, housing costs above US avg. Intercity Transit (free). When planning your budget based on a salary from Generation YES Corp, consider these typical monthly expenses:
